The Commonwealth of Massachusetts William Francis Galvin, Secretary of the Commonwealth Public Records Division Rebecca S. Murray Supervisor of Records December 14, 2021 SPR21/3122 Jennifer M. Staples, Esq. Office of the Chief Legal Counsel Massachusetts Department of State Police General Headquarters 470 Worcester Road Framingham, MA 01702 Dear Attorney Staples: I have received the petition of Jon Cubetus of the Boston College Innocence Program appealing the nonresponse of the Massachusetts Department of State Police (Department) to a request for public records. G. L. c. 66, § 10A; see also 950 C.M.R. 32.08(1). On October 15, 2021, Mr. Cubetus requested records related to forensic testing performed in a certain court case. Claiming to not yet have received a response, Mr. Cubetus petitioned this office, and this appeal, SPR21/3122, was opened as a result. Under the Public Records Law and the Access Regulations (Regulations) all requests for public records must be met with a response within 10 business days from receipt of the request. G. L. c. 66, § 10(a)-(b). The response may contain, among other things, an offer to provide records, a fee estimate for provision of the records, or a denial. G. L. c. 66, § 10(b). All records custodians must comply with both the Public Records Law and the Regulations with respect to the timeliness of response. Despite being notified of the opening of this appeal, it is unclear if a response has been provided. Accordingly, the Department is ordered to provide Mr. Cubetus with a response to the request, provided in a manner consistent with this order, the Public Records Law and its Regulations within 10 business days. A copy of the response must be provided to this office. It is preferable to send an electronic copy of this response to this office at pre@sec.state.ma.us.
